Understanding Ileum Ulcers
Ileum ulcers, or ulcers located in the ileum, are a type of gastrointestinal issue. They occur when the inner lining of the ileum is damaged, leading to sores or ulcers. These ulcers can be painful and may cause significant discomfort, potentially leading to complications if left untreated.
Curability of Ileum Ulcers
While ileum ulcers can be curable, the exact treatment approach depends on the underlying cause and severity of the condition. In many cases, a combination of medical treatments, lifestyle modifications, and follow-ups with healthcare professionals can lead to complete healing.
Medications for Ileum Ulcers
Medications play a critical role in the treatment of ileum ulcers. Typically, the following methods are employed:
Antibiotics: If an H. pylori infection is detected, antibiotics can effectively eradicate the bacteria. This is crucial for the healing process. Proton Pump Inhibitors (PPIs): These medications reduce the production of stomach acid, which can exacerbate ulcers. H2-receptor Antagonists: These drugs also help reduce stomach acid, providing relief and promoting healing. Adopting certain lifestyle changes can significantly support the healing process and improve overall health:
Dietary Adjustments: Avoiding spicy, acidic, and fatty foods, and incorporating a diet rich in fiber can be beneficial. Stress Management: Stress can exacerbate ulcer symptoms. Practices such as meditation, yoga, and deep breathing can help manage stress levels.
